Output 81b9e535431bfbd215eb3701f7acd894cbc7d36259f9ad325985bccb4a95edc6:4

value
3703166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b15e4c73a2732315f5d9dac8481826c29c32bad OP_EQUAL
address
34AEPvQoXNwqdjtKkTpZynZqui75foa8WG
transaction
81b9e535431bfbd215eb3701f7acd894cbc7d36259f9ad325985bccb4a95edc6
confirmations
373721
spent
true